What is editing?

And why is it such a big part of the process?

There are 3 major parts in what makes a photographer’s style unique.

First, there is the personality: you want to feel at ease with the professional who will capture your memories – it’s the experience you’ll remember when looking at your photos.

Second, there is the way they shoot: the framing and composition of their photos, the emotion shown…

And last but not least: the editing. The photo straight out of camera is like raw dough for a baker; the editing is the cooking process of photography, where a lot of the magic happens. It’s a way to get all your photos to look consistent and really professional. We edit your photos in terms of lighting, contrast, colours…so that all the potential of the image is revealed.

A Family Photoshoot can be a bit stressful, for both the parents and the children. However, my style allows me to work around it. Because I want to have photos of natural and authentic moments, a photoshoot isn’t about posing, especially when children are involved. We talk beforehand about things your children like to do, their favorite books, toys, and we plan activities to do during the sessions. Making it about them is often enough to get them to be cooperative!

If we’re talking about a session, there are two possibilities : either we postpone the session to another day, or we embrace the rain. Bad weather can actually look great in photos : stormy skies look more dramatic than blue skies, and rain with a transparent umbrella give out a very romantic vibe.
